Output ad21d308c75413896ac816ee722da882d4c8adc73da3e7a2a652f7c859b9c908:1

value
1090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 377956c4d061230100e89d4fc0de2e51532bc21e OP_EQUAL
address
36kLSsX52SEU6ekyE2CWy2Hg2z4raquHn7
transaction
ad21d308c75413896ac816ee722da882d4c8adc73da3e7a2a652f7c859b9c908
spent
true